DANCE DEPARTMENT MISSION
Training students to be wholistic, moving and thinking, artists. Our curriculum will equip students with the discipline, focus, and perseverance needed to be a prominent force within and outside of the field of dance.

OUR GOALS
Provide a safe, positive environment for students to grow, create, experiment, and take risks
Teach self discipline, advocacy, commitment, responsibility, and life long ethics
Develop individual art language
Interdisciplinary productions
Exposure to career possibilites in dance
